Engine compartment fuses
Access to the fuses
F Unclip the cover.
F Change the fuse (see corresponding
paragraph).
F When you have finished, close the cover
carefully to ensure correct sealing of the
fusebox.
Fuse
N°
Rating
(A)
Functions
F1 40 Air conditioning.
F2 30 / 40 Stop & Start.
F3 30 Passenger compartment fusebox.
F4 70 Passenger compartment fusebox.
F5 70 Built-in Systems Interface (BSI).
F6 60 Cooling fan assembly.
F7 80 Built-in Systems Interface (BSI).
F8 15 Engine management, petrol pump.
F9 15 Engine management.
F10 15 Engine management.
F11 20 Engine management.
F12 5 Cooling fan assembly.
F13 5 Built-in Systems Interface (BSI).
F14 5 Battery charge unit (non Stop & Start engine).
F15 5 Stop & Start.
F17 5 Built-in Systems Interface (BSI).
F18 10 Right hand main beam headlamp.
The fusebox is placed in the engine
compartment near the battery.
